 * Hello,
 * i try proPlayer and i have this error : **Parse error: syntax error, unexpected‘]’,
   expecting ‘(‘ in /mnt/129/sdb/6/f/web.codeur/wp-content/plugins/proplayer/pro-
   player.php on line 65**
 * after looking the proplayer.php and constants.php files, it seems that the author
   make mistake between **PHP4 & PHP5**.
 * the guys who have this error use PHP4.
 * if you don’t want this error, you need to upgrade to PHP5 or make a lot of modification
   in the proplayer php files ->
    1. delete the Constant class
    2. replace each variables in “constants.php” by a define()
    3. make all modifications in files calling Constant variable
